TriNet Group, Inc. (TNET), Thursday announced financial outlook for the fiscal year 2025, expecting adjusted profit of $3.25 to $4.75 per share.
The company sees profit per share of $1.90 to $3.40, and revenue between $4.9 billion and $5.1 billion for the same period.
Analysts, on average, estimate earnings of $5.52 per share, and revenue of $1.21 billion for the fiscal year 2025.
In the pre-market hours, TriNet's stock is trading at $75, down 18.59 percent on the New York Stock Exchange.
